Going Paleo? Add Paleo Pro Aztec Vanilla to your pantry
I would strongly recommend folks jumping onto the Paleo bandwagon to stock up on Paleo Protein Pro, Aztec Vanilla.Paleo Pro is a great product supplement for eating clean. I just finished a six week strict Paleo diet challenge, encouraged by Crossfit coaches after seeing my gains with macro-nutrients in muscle mass and lowering body fat and weight. When I started the strict Paleo challenge, I couldn’t get enough protein in, initially. Additionally, eating strictly was a challenge when traveling or for long days in the office. This product saved my bacon during the six weeks, figuratively and literally. It was, and is, my go-to supplement during the day for a healthy protein snack or after a workout.The product tastes good and blends well. The Aztec Vanilla aroma hits you when you open the bag. With 12-16 ounces of water, it goes down well. To be fair, all protein powders are not the same as eating real food. However, if you add a banana the product is super smooth and tastes great, finishing with that taste of vanilla without being overpowered with a chemical finish. Add berries and some ice to kick it up a notch. The powder blended well in water bottles with simple shaking and in a blender with other items. There was no chunky or grainy residue, or clumping when blending, from my experiences.The price to value ratio is solid. At around $40 a bag for 15 servings of 26g of protein each, that’s about $2.60 a drink – reasonable when you consider alternatives that are not Paleo, are similarly priced but contain ingredients you might want to avoid.

Get rid of the sweetners and “natural flavors”
I have used this powder for over a year but in my quest to continue to clean up my diet and put my autoimmune disease into remission I am discontinuing use.1. This is way too sweet and I would rather real vanilla bean instead of monk fruit or supposed “natural flavors”.2. “Natural flavors” is not specific enough and in many studies it has been shown that companies that put that are still mixing things in that while supposedly natural, are not necessarily good or organic.3. Ditch the egg whites too. Egg whites can cause issues for some people with autoimmune issues which is often why people follow a Paleo diet. It also doesn’t really need to be added as good and well sourced beef collagen would be enough.Otherwise, this is a good protein powder. Mixes well and for the most part is clean compared to many other products out there. I’d use it again if they got rid of the above.
